The percentage argument is based on the number of chunks dirty. It was chosen to use number of chunks due to large drives requiring smaller and smaller percentages (eg, 32TB drives-> 1% is 320GB). The first patch fixes a performance gap observed in RAID1 configurations. With a synchronous qd1 workload, bitmap writes can easily become almost half of the I/O. This could be argued to be expected, but undesirable. Moving the unplug operation to the periodic delay work seemed to help the situation. The second part of this set adds a new field in the superblock and version, allowing for a new argument through mdadm specifying the number of chunks allowed to be dirty before flushing. Accompanying this set is an RFC for mdadm patch. It lacks documentation which will be sent in v2 if this changeset is appropriate.
